Passyunk Square Neighborhood Guide

By Todd Hovanec on April 16, 2020

Passyunk Square is a neighborhood in South Philadelphia whose name derived from a park framed by Reed Street, Wharton Street, 12th Street and 13th Street. Originally known as Passyunk Square, that same park is today called Columbus Square.

Passyunk Square is anchored by the commercial corridor on -- you guessed it -- Passyunk Avenue. This district has solidified itself as one of the most popular shopping and entertainment destinations in Philadelphia, with terrific boutiques and world class restaurants.

Where is Passyunk Square in Philadelphia? 

Passyunk Square is located south of Bella Vista, north of Central South Philadelphia and Hawthorne, east of Point Breeze, and west of Dickinson Narrows. On a map, the neighborhood is bounded by 6th Street to the east, Washington Avenue to the north, Broad Street to the west, and Tasker Street to the south.

Architectural Appeal

Like many of Philadelphia’s neighborhoods, Passyunk Square consists mostly of low-rise single-family and small multi-family brick buildings (two or three apartments, generally). On Passyunk Avenue, some intersections host mixed-use buildings, typically with a commercial space on the ground floor and one or two apartments above. 

As has happened across much of the rest of the city, but to a lesser degree, vacant parcels have been scooped up and built upon by developers. This is primarily due to the Passyunk’s ascension to one of the most popular sections of the city, in tandem with rising prices (and a tax-abatement program).

Getting Around Passyunk Square

Passyunk Square enjoys a fantastic location within the city. Center City office buildings are easily accessible via a quick bicycle jaunt or a 30-40 minute walk (1.5 - 2.0 miles), depending on origination point and destination.

Public transportation options abound as well. The SEPTA 64 crosstown bus line runs along Washington Ave. and the 47 runs north and south along 7th and 8th Streets, respectively. The Broad Street line is not far away depending on where you are originating from in the neighborhood. Indeed, Passyunk Square is well connected.

Best Cheesesteak in Passyunk Square

Passyunk Square is ground zero for the great debate between locals and tourists over the best steak in Philly. While Pat’s and Geno’s get all the attention, the best steak in Passyunk Square is easily Cosmi’s Deli at 1501 S. 8th St. It’s where the locals go.

Afterward, head down the block to Termini Brothers Bakery for a mouth-watering selection of desserts and pastries.

Market Snapshot

Due to the top-notch, convenient location within the city and its local entertainment options and amenities, Passyunk Square continues to be a desired neighborhood. 

Pricing has creeped up as developers have built upon most of the empty lots in the area. More recently, as land is no longer easily available, developers are now gutting older two-story homes and adding a third story in order to appeal to today’s modern purchaser seeking more space.
